And the reality is, your cuticles aren’t just “extra skin around your nails.” They’re a protective seal, like the rubber gasket on your refrigerator door.

Cuticles seal the space between your skin and nail, keeping bacteria out and moisture balanced.

But when repeated handwashing, harsh soap, or winter weather strips natural oils, your cuticles dry out and crack.

Those cracks? That’s where hangnails come from.

And here’s why it’s worse after 50: Your skin produces 50-70% less natural oil. That means your cuticles are drying out faster and cracking more easily than they did years ago.
